Abstract

A receptacle RF connector (100) includes an inner conductor (2) having an unsealed tubular section (20) having retention walls (23, 24) configured to extend into a body of a dielectric block (1). Thus, the conductor is securely held within the dielectric block by the engagement of the retention walls and the retention slots (11, 12) so as to avoid the un-stable assembly of the conductor and the dielectric block of the prior art.
